Fourteen years after its release, we are still arguing about a spinning piece of metal. Christopher Nolan’s sci-fi heist masterpiece left audiences staring at a black screen, desperately trying to figure out if Leonardo DiCaprio’s Dom Cobb actually made it home to his children or if he remained trapped in the deep, subconscious prison of Limbo.

The debate usually splits down the middle: team “he’s awake” vs. team “it’s all a dream.” But both sides are missing the forest for the trees. By focusing entirely on that silver spinning top, we are falling for the director’s ultimate magic trick.
